Guanxin Shutong Capsule (GXSTC) is a traditional Chinese medicinal formula composed of five herbal ingredients: Fructus Choerospondiatis (Guangzao), Salvia miltiorrhiza (Danshen), Flos Caryophylli (Dingxiang), Borneolum (Bingpian), and Concretio Silicea Bambusae (Tianzhuhuang)[1][2]. It has been clinically used in China for the treatment of coronary heart disease, angina pectoris, chest pain, depression, palpitation, and other cardiovascular diseases for nearly a decade[2][3][4][5][7]. Mechanistically, GXSTC exerts multi-target effects including antioxidative activity by reducing NADPH oxidase expression and oxidative stress markers; anti-inflammatory action by lowering interleukin-1β and interleukin-6 levels; endothelial protection via upregulation of endothelial nitric oxide synthase (eNOS) and increased nitric oxide production; inhibition of neuronal apoptosis; and modulation of vascular endothelial function[1][3][5]. Experimental studies have shown that GXSTC can reduce myocardial infarct size in animal models and improve neurological outcomes after cerebral ischemia[2][5].
